Plunger:


bettor is a very good tool for dealing with plumbing problems. It is used to clear obstructions in toilets, cooking area sinks, and other drains pipes in your house. There are various kinds of plungers for managing different types of drainpipe obstructions so you should have different types and also sizes of bettor depending upon the one that fits your drains pipes. There are 2 major sorts of bettor: the flange and the mug. Each of these has its particular applications for clearing drain clogs.
A basin wrench: this is one more device that must remain in every home. When doing plumbing repair work, it might be needed to chill out screws and sink plumbing fixtures. The basin wrench makes this possible and is also utilized to tighten nuts also. This wrench has a head that rotates at the back as well as front. This assists to get to smaller sized nuts or hold the tap handles and also pipelines.

Pliers:


The type of pliers recommended for plumbing is the tongue-and-groove pliers. They are utilized to tighten up and also loosen up nuts and also screws. They can also be controlled to hold nuts and bolts in place and also use to hold as well as pick items. Pliers are very valuable tools for DIY plumbings.

Auger:


This is also known as a drain snake and is used for clearing drainpipe obstructions. This device is put right into blocked drains to take out obstructions and also cruds from the drainpipe. You put it in the drain and spin it to damage blockages into tinier bits for easy cleaning.

Teflon tape:


This is also commonly called plumber's tape. It is made use of to snugly secure stack joints and fitting. The tapes remain in rolls reduced to particular sizes and sizes. It is an impervious seal as well as because of this, it can be used to resist leaks till professional aid arrives.

Signs You Need to Call an Emergency Plumber


Most people don’t anticipate having a plumbing problem. After all, your home’s piping is probably the last thing on your mind, even as you wash your hands, flush the toilet, and take a shower. If you think you’re having an emergency, call a plumber as soon as possible.


TOP 10 REASONS TO CALL AN EMERGENCY PLUMBER


  • Gurgling sounds: Something could be blocking your sewer line if the toilet gurgles when you drain the bathtub, or if you hear gurgling from the sink while the washing machine runs. Call an emergency plumber before the problem develops into a backed-up sewer!


  • Stubborn toilet clog: If a foreign object has lodged itself in the drainpipe, a plunger will only get you so far. An emergency plumber has more advanced tools and techniques to clear stubborn toilet clogs.


  • Shower or sink won’t drain: You may find that you can’t clear a stopped-up sink or shower drain with the tools available to you. To get things flowing again, call a plumber for drain cleaning services.


  • Sounds of water running: If you hear water running through the pipes while no one is using the plumbing, there could be a leak somewhere. You need expert leak detection to locate and fix the source of the problem before it causes any more harm.


  • Sewage odor: Be wary of bad smells with no apparent source. A broken sewer vent or pipe could be to blame, which is not only unpleasant but could also cause environmental and health issues. Professional sewer repair should set things right again.


  • Low water pressure: Sometimes, you can blame a lack of water flow on a clogged aerator. Unscrew this from the faucet and soak it in vinegar to remove mineral deposits. If the problem persists, call a professional for help.


  • Frozen pipes: Low water pressure in the winter could be caused by a frozen pipe. You must act fast to prevent the pipe from bursting and potentially causing significant water damage.


  • Burst or dripping pipes: If you’re too late, and a frozen pipe has burst, don’t panic—turn the main water shut-off valve to stop the flow of water and prevent property damage until an emergency plumber arrives.


  • No hot water: A problem with your water heater can make a hot shower suddenly turn ice-cold. Fortunately, an emergency plumber can perform the repair you need to restore your supply of hot water.


  • Leaking fixture or hose: If you see water flowing out from under the dishwasher, washing machine, or ice maker, the hose behind the appliance may have sprung a leak. See if you can tighten the connection to stop the dripping. Otherwise, turn off the water and call an emergency plumber.
